When I booked this hotel, I didn't get a note that there is a free shuttle ONLY from airport to the hotel, but going back to the airport NOT FREE you have to pay 10 CHF. Or take the bus and pay only about 2 or 3 CHF and walk about 5 minutes from the bus stop which I did. I only have 1 light luggage, so not bad. Receptionist not much helpful. I'm a Holiday Inn member and they even charged me 5 CHF for a cup of cappuccino on the espresso machine (it's not even made from scratch, just press the button and there's your coffee).

Title: Disappointing and unfair parking policy – charged different rates to different guests
My recent stay at the Holiday Inn Express Zürich Airport (July 16-18, 2026) was unfortunately overshadowed by an unfair experience at check-in.
While waiting in the queue, I overheard the guests in front of me being told they would receive a discount on parking and would only be charged a nominal fee of 10 CHF for their car. However, when it was my turn at the front desk, I was informed that the parking fee would be 24 CHF per day. This meant I was being charged 14 CHF more per day for the exact same service, simply because I was next in line.
This inconsistent and seemingly arbitrary pricing practice left a very bad impression. It feels like an unfair policy and is certainly not a good way to treat guests. Others have also noted the parking is expensive for a suburban hotel , but the inconsistency is what makes this particularly frustrating.
I would advise future guests to confirm the parking fee clearly before checking in.
